The meaning and origin of Bella
The name Bella means “"Beautiful"” and has Italian origins. From the Italian and Spanish word for 'beautiful', and also a short form of Isabella or Arabella. Its popularity surged after the Twilight series character Bella Swan.
Variants and related names
Bella is related to several other names you may recognize: Isabella, Arabella, Belle, Annabella. These share a common root or are spelling and language variants of the same name.
How popular is the name Bella?
Rose rapidly in the late 2000s into the US top 50, boosted by the Twilight franchise.
